Eurochem picks banks for re-entry to bonds

Russian fertiliser company Eurochem has mandated Barclays, BNP Paribas, Citi and Sberbank for its first Eurobond since 2007. Investor meetings for the Reg S/144A deal will start in London on Friday, before moving to Boston and Los Angeles on Monday and finishing in New York on Tuesday.
